What Is Personal Injury Chiropractic Care?

Personal injury chiropractic care is specialized treatment for musculoskeletal injuries sustained in an accident — most commonly car accidents. At VAL Chiropractic in San Jose, Dr. Lam Nguyen, D.C. evaluates and treats accident-related injuries including whiplash, neck pain, back pain, soft tissue damage, and headaches.

Beyond treatment, Dr. Nguyen provides the thorough medical documentation that personal injury attorneys need to support their clients' claims. Careful documentation of injury onset, severity, functional limitations, and treatment progress can be critical to a successful personal injury case.

Important: Soft-tissue injuries and whiplash often don't appear until hours or days after a collision. Getting evaluated promptly — even if you feel okay — protects both your health and your legal claim.

Common Injuries After a Car Accident

Accidents can cause a wide range of injuries, many of which may not be immediately apparent. Common conditions Dr. Nguyen evaluates and treats include:

  • Whiplash — rapid back-and-forth neck motion that strains muscles, tendons, and the cervical spine
  • Neck pain and stiffness — often the first symptom, sometimes appearing hours or days after the collision
  • Upper and lower back pain — spinal compression and soft tissue injury from impact forces
  • Headaches — cervicogenic headaches from neck tension and cervical spine dysfunction
  • Shoulder pain — from airbag deployment, bracing, or seatbelt forces
  • Soft tissue injuries — muscle strains, ligament sprains, and fascia damage

How Chiropractic Care May Help

Chiropractic care is one of the most commonly used conservative treatments for auto accident injuries. Dr. Nguyen's approach may help by restoring cervical and lumbar spinal alignment, reducing muscle tension and soft tissue inflammation, improving range of motion, and addressing nerve compression. Individual results vary — Dr. Nguyen will evaluate your specific injuries and discuss a realistic care plan.

Do I need to see a chiropractor after a car accident?

Even if you feel okay after a crash, soft-tissue injuries and whiplash can take hours or days to become symptomatic. A chiropractic evaluation can help identify injuries early, support your recovery, and create documentation for your personal injury claim.

How soon should I see a chiropractor after a car accident?

As soon as possible — ideally within 72 hours of the accident. Early documentation strengthens your legal claim, and prompt care may reduce the risk of injuries becoming chronic.
